Shurabad (Persian : شوراباد, also Romanized as Shūrābād; also known as Qal‘eh-ye Shūrābeh) [1] is a village in Now Bandegan Rural District, Now Bandegan District, Fasa County, Fars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 252, in 47 families. [2]
Persian, also known by its endonym Farsi, is one of the Western Iranian languages within the Indo-Iranian branch of the Indo-European language family. It is primarily spoken in Iran, Afghanistan, and Tajikistan, Uzbekistan and some other regions which historically were Persianate societies and considered part of Greater Iran. It is written right to left in the Persian alphabet, a modified variant of the Arabic script, which itself evolved from the Aramaic alphabet.
Now Bandegan Rural District is a rural district (dehestan) in Now Bandegan District, Fasa County, Fars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 8,746, in 2,092 families. The rural district has 26 villages.
Now Bandegan District is a district (bakhsh) in Fasa County, Fars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 11,679, in 2,858 families. The District has one city: Now Bandegan. The District has one rural district (dehestan): Now Bandegan Rural District.
